Follow-up Comment #14, bug #38928 (project octave):
Hopefully Mike can try some of the permutations. If you look at the
.deps/*.Plo files though you see that we are generating dependencies on hdf5.h
for huge numbers of files which inherit through the ov*.h header files.
For example, libinterp/operators/.deps/*.Plo has 127 files that depend on
hdf5.h, but these don't really "depend" in the sense of actually using
function prototypes from hdf5.h.
